🌿🤖 Wild Robot Minecraft Adventures: Books & Blocks STEAM & ELA Club for Kids 🤖🌿

▬▬▬▬▬▬ 📚 What’s This Adventure About? 📚 ▬▬▬▬▬▬

What if a robot crash-landed in the wild and had to learn to survive? In this exciting book & Minecraft club, we’ll journey through The Wild Robot series—bringing the story to life with reading, discussion, and creative Minecraft builds!

Perfect for animal lovers, bookworms, and Minecraft fans, this class merges literature, creativity, and hands-on STEAM learning. Whether your child is a reluctant reader or an avid explorer, this club will spark their imagination, critical thinking, and storytelling skills while building in Minecraft!

▬▬▬▬▬▬ 🌲 What We’ll Do Each Week: 🌲 ▬▬▬▬▬▬

✨ Listen & Discuss – I’ll read sections aloud while students engage in discussions about survival, nature, friendship, and robotics.
✨ Explore STEAM Themes – Learn real-life animal behaviors, survival skills, and robotics concepts that connect to the story.
✨ Create in Minecraft – Build scenes from the book, from Roz’s rocky island to animal homes, robots, and survival tools!
✨ Think Like Engineers & Explorers – Solve challenges inspired by Roz’s journey, using problem-solving and creativity.

▬▬▬▬▬▬ 🤖 Hands-On Exploration & Minecraft Challenges 🏗️ ▬▬▬▬▬▬

Each week, students will recreate key scenes and design their own inventions based on the book. Some examples include:
🌲 Roz’s Island: Build the rugged landscape where Roz learns to survive!
🐻 Animal Homes: Construct shelters for Wild Robot’s animal friends.
⚡ Survival Gadgets: Design inventions that help Roz adapt to her new world.
🌦️ Weather & Nature Builds: Create storms, seasons, and habitats using Minecraft mechanics.
